Output 21d60fd3096e6cd9ad288e38b3e79c572b90198307847f2a43cb2117804308b1:0

value
474551339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c81d8b0e7f63e35cfd3fbb75e0a879e6563d5ddb OP_EQUAL
address
3Kw8Tc94qwcgeFUnZJCBiTVpQyPCEVC7V4
transaction
21d60fd3096e6cd9ad288e38b3e79c572b90198307847f2a43cb2117804308b1
spent
true